Dear Readers,

The text of this book was originally written as a gift for my cousin Nanci Hersh, an award winning artist, to help her find the right words to tell her 3 year old and 5 year old boys about her cancer. Several years after her successful fight with cancer, and some gentle nudging on my part, Nanci agreed to illustrate the text I had written for her boys.

As you will discover, several of Nanci's exquisite drawings capture the reality of cancer in ways children can easily comprehend. There are also many other illustrations that suggest ways in which a child can help someone who has cancer and, in the process, empower the child. Once our endeavor was completed, we realized that Butterfly Kisses and Wishes on Wings was much more than a storybook. It had evolved into a resource that could be given as a gift and used to educate and support many other children who are facing the cancer of a loved one.

We are pleased that you have chosen our book to help guide you as you teach a child about cancer. We hope that its words and pictures will foster an honest and open dialogue between you and the child listening or reading along. Additionally, we hope that you will see the magic that Butterfly Kisses and Wishes on Wings has in bringing children to a clearer understanding of cancer, and the realization that they have great power within themselves to be an active and integral part of their loved one's cancer journey.
